The heat of neutralization of a strong base and strong acid is 57.0 kJ. The heat released when 0.5 mol of HNO3 solution is added to 0.2 mol of NaOH solution is ____?

Detailed Solution
NaOH is the limiting reagent. ∴ Heat liberated by neutralizing 0.2 mol of each= 57 x0.2 kJ = 11.4 kJ
